Output 30bc89719d539fabc788621648426d7560e30aaf8fc2ead85245dcab3a5323dd:11

value
2665740311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4913bf74b2f04fdea3bd2041020db7d968f3f156 OP_EQUAL
address
38MQuesT7uEgYRX65H8gP5ao1N3GiBeCpX
transaction
30bc89719d539fabc788621648426d7560e30aaf8fc2ead85245dcab3a5323dd
spent
true